Chevrolet Sonic Owner's Manual: Service Parts Identification Label

Chevrolet Sonic Owner's Manual / Technical Data / Vehicle Identification / Service Parts Identification Label

This label, in the spare tire well in the trunk, has the following information:

Do not remove this label from the vehicle.
